I'm rather new to DNN and I'm looking for a way to set up a role for which all content changes require reviewing.  I'd like it if all other users with the Editor role receive an email telling them that one of them needs to review the change that was just made and "OK" it.  Is this something that's easy to set up with DNN or will it require a lot of custom programming?  Thanks in advance.
 
New Post
7/28/2010 6:38 PM
 
It sounds like the Content Approval Workflow is what I want, and I tried setting that as the selected workflow on a content module, but I don't see how it bubbles up to an approver, etc.
 
New Post
7/30/2010 11:50 AM
 
I found the source code for the workflow in DotNetNuke.Professional.HtmlPro.dll.  Part of the problem is that it's using the email address of the portal admin as the To and From, instead of the recipient being the approver, which is baffling.  And ideally the editor could not be an approver and vice versa, but I don't see how to implement that without custom code.
